Analyze Your Tap

Keep in mind that odor and taste are one thing, but it is essential to find other contaminants specific to your area or municipality. That way, you can choose the best pitcher or water filter type to help you handle all of them.

According to CCR, the level of contaminants can affect other aspects of water, which means that you can find traces of microbes, pesticides, and heavy metals, among other things.

Keep in mind that your home’s plumbing system can also affect water quality. If you have the one built with lead, which means before 1986, you should check out your water for information and other heavy metals.

When it comes to lead, you should know that the minimal levels can lead to serious health issues, including decreased kidney function, hypertension, and reproductive problems.

Apart from that, it can lead to slowed development, learning issues, and hearing problems in children.

You should check out for the local or state health department to get test kits that will feature an ability to check for different contaminants. Or you can visit a certified lab for testing, which is a much more effective and accurate option.

Before choosing a proper pitcher, you should conduct a thorough analysis that will help you determine the contaminant levels.

You Can Find Wide Array of Water Pitchers

As soon as you determine things you should filter out, we recommend finding a pitcher that will feature a certification mark to handle everything that may affect you in the future.

However, you won’t find a pitcher that will clear everything, which is something you should remember while searching. Most of them will remove contaminants, including zinc and chlorine, but only a few high-end models can remove lead.
